Abstract
The invention belongs to agriculture cultivation field, be specifically related to a kind of method of artificial propagation bracken spore seedling, concrete operation step is, 1) spore collection and storage, 2) prepare before sowing, 3) medium heats, and 4) humus soil heating, 5) prepare compost, 6) farming in plot, 7) bracken spore is sowed, 8) cultivation of bracken spore, 9) obtain bracken spore seedling.Present method solves bracken spore breeding germination rate, key issue that survival rate is not high, achieve bracken spore Fast-propagation, high-yield and high-efficiency, bracken spore germination rate can be made to reach 90%, survival rate 95%, the transplanting of rice shoot more easily survives,, reduce costs meanwhile, improve profit.

Background technology
Fiddlehead is one of main wild vegetable of China, with the young tender leaf of fist volume and petiole for edible part, very popular.Because people are to the excessive collection of wild pteridophyte, make fiddlehead not grow normally and to multiply, the sharply atrophy causing wild resource is even exhausted, and supply falls short of demand for fiddlehead product, and the artificial cultivation of fiddlehead and natural cultivation have wide market prospects.Fiddlehead belongs to high spore producing plant, and it does not have seed, can only lean on spore and root-like stock vegetative propagation, and sporogenesis difficulty is large, the cycle is long, therefore production does not above generally adopt.The spontaneous fiddlehead root-like stock in field is more thin and weak, of poor quality, and reproduction coefficient is lower, looks not strong, easy aging limits throughput, limits the development of fiddlehead cultivation.
General method of planting fiddlehead in the woods is sow spore under shade density 90% condition, and normal conditions rudiment after 60 days, spore germination rate is at about 5-6%, and survival rate is at 1-2%.Although at the soil contamination grade of sylvan life than much lower in farmland, the clean conditions of soil still cannot make spore have very high germination rate.Because bracken spore seed is quite small, very easily infect, dead at once once infection spore, so the method that tradition cultivates bracken spore needs to improve.
Summary of the invention
The object of the invention is, for prior art Problems existing, to provide a kind of method that bracken spore is bred,
Its technical scheme is:
1) spore collection and storage: gather full spore, spore cleanliness >=60%, sieves and makes bracken spore powder, freezing stand-by;
2) prepare before sowing: before sowing, conidial powder is taken out, thaws, freezing, the process of again thawing;
3) medium heats: choose appropriate tree root, be cut into 3-7cm section shape, put into combustion furnace, and heating, obtains medium, take out stand-by;
4) humus soil heats: get appropriate humus soil, put into combustion furnace, and heating, obtains the humus soil through sterilization treatment, take out stand-by;
5) compost is prepared: by step 3) medium that obtains and step 4) humus soil mixing after sterilization treatment, obtain final compost;
6) farming in plot: hanging wire makees bed, spreads plastic film in bed surface, step 5) compost that obtains is laid on the plastic film of bed surface, then sprinkles water on compost, and soil moisture is 80%-90%;
7) bracken spore is sowed: put in sprayer by the conidial powder of soaking 25-30 minute with the red toxin of 300g/L, be sprayed at equably on compost, every square metre of conidial powder fountain height is 0.1g-0.2g, after planting uses smooth implements to shakeout soil, then covers on soil with preservative film;
8) cultivation of bracken spore: before after planting there is prothallium, keep bed surface relative moisture 85%-90%, preservative film is removed after there is prothallium, watering keeps the native relative moisture of table at 65%-75%, prothallus development becomes in the process of true leaf, growth temperature at 20-28 DEG C, shade density 80%-85%.
9) obtain bracken spore seedling: after planting 110-140 days, highly reach 20-23cm, the rice shoot of the long 20-30cm of underground rhizome is seedling, transplant.
Step 1) in bracken spore powder growth at the edge of blade bottom end, when conidial powder flavescence look or the dirty-green of blade edge, select physical purity of seed >=60%, ripe blade, cut and put into paper bag, in 25 ~ 27 DEG C of airing 40-50 hour, sift out with 300 order-500 order dusting covers, obtain bracken spore powder, conidial powder is positioned over-20 ~-25 DEG C freezing stand-by.
Step 2) in thaw, freezing, the processing procedure of again thawing is: conidial powder taken out and add 5-25 DEG C of cold water soak 5-6 hour, be placed on 90-100 hour under-40 DEG C ~-35 DEG C conditions, again the conidial powder of freezing mistake is placed into 5-7 days under-5 DEG C ~ 0 DEG C condition, finally places under 5 DEG C ~ 10 DEG C conditions after 20-30 hour and sow.
Step 3) described in tree root be one or more in toothed oak tree, elm, birch, willow or maple, heating and temperature control is at 250-300 DEG C, and the heat time is 60-80 minute;
Step 4) described in humus soil be humus soil in toothed oak tree, elm, birch, willow or maple below one or more trees, heating and temperature control is at 150-200 DEG C, and the heat time is 30-40 minute.
Step 5) described in medium and humus soil be mixed into compost according to the mass ratio of 1:5 ~ 7.
Step 6) in bed surface effective width be 1 meter to 1.2 meters, work road width is 30cm to 40cm, height of bed 15-25cm, and the compost thickness be laid on bed surface plastic film is 5cm-10cm, and porosity is 35%-50%.
Step 8) in bracken spore before after planting there is prothallium, every day sprays with sprayer, keep bed surface relative moisture at 80%-95%, remove preservative film after there is prothallium, used every 2-3 days the sterile water of 15-20 DEG C to spray and keep for 2-3 times the native relative moisture of table at 65%-75%.
In the method for the invention, step 2) in thaw, freezing, course of defrosting, step 4 again) heating of medium and step 5) sterilization treatment humous is crucial part of the present invention.
Advantageous Effects
The present invention is by freezing, the process of thawing to spore, with the preparation to compost, solve bracken spore breeding germination rate, key issue that survival rate is not high, achieve bracken spore Fast-propagation, high-yield and high-efficiency, according to this method breeding bracken spore, can make bracken spore germination rate reach 90%, survival rate 95%, the transplanting of rice shoot more easily survives.
, reduce costs meanwhile, improve profit, according to the method for propagative spore seedling of the present invention, after transplanting, 3 years raw fiddlehead per mu yields make a profit be sylvan life sporogenesis 2-3 doubly, be 4-5 times of Propagation of Rhizomes;
According to the method for propagative spore seedling of the present invention, after transplanting, 5 years raw fiddlehead output make a profit be sylvan life sporogenesis 1.5-2 doubly, be the 2.5-3 of Propagation of Rhizomes doubly, according to method breeding bracken spore of the present invention, there is clear superiority as seen.
Embodiment
Following examples are used for the present invention is described in further detail, but are not construed as limiting the invention, and concrete data of the present invention are only limitted to absolutely not these embodiments.
Embodiment 1
Operating procedure is as follows:
1) spore collection and storage: bracken spore powder grows the edge in blade bottom end, when conidial powder flavescence look or the dirty-green of blade edge, select physical purity of seed >=60%, ripe blade, cut and put into paper bag, bracken spore in 25 DEG C of airings 40 hours, sifts out with 500 order dusting covers after gathering, obtain bracken spore powder, conidial powder is positioned over-25 DEG C freezing stand-by;
2) prepare before sowing: before sowing, conidial powder is taken out and adds 15 DEG C of cold water soak 5 hours, be placed on lower 100 hours of-35 DEG C of conditions, then the conidial powder of freezing mistake is placed into lower 7 days of-5 DEG C of conditions, finally places under 10 DEG C of conditions after 30 hours and can sow;
3) medium heats: choose the arbitrary proportioning mixing of 100kg toothed oak tree, elm, birch and willow, be cut into 3-7cm section shape, put into combustion furnace and heat, heating and temperature control is at 300 DEG C, and the heat time is 70 minutes, obtains medium, takes out stand-by;
4) humus soil heats: get 600kg toothed oak tree humus soil below, put into combustion furnace and heat, heating and temperature control is at 180 DEG C, and the heat time is 40 minutes, obtains the humus soil through sterilization treatment, takes out stand-by;
5) compost is prepared: by step 3) medium that obtains and step 4) humus soil mixing after sterilization treatment, obtain final compost;
6) farming in plot: hanging wire makees bed, bed surface effective width is 1.2 meters, work road width is 35cm, height of bed 15-25cm, bed surface spreads plastic film, and tile compost on plastic film, thickness is 5cm-10cm, sprinkle water on compost, maintenance soil moisture is 80%-90% again, ensures that the porosity of compost is 35%-50%;
7) bracken spore is sowed: will put in sprayer by the conidial powder that the red toxin C A (920) of 300g/L is soaked 30 minutes, be sprayed at equably on compost, every square metre of conidial powder fountain height is 0.1g-0.2g, after planting use smooth implements to shakeout soil, then cover on soil with preservative film;
8) cultivation of bracken spore: before after planting there is prothallium, every day sprays with sprayer, keep bed surface relative moisture 85%-90%, growth temperature is at 20 DEG C, remove preservative film after there is prothallium, used the sterile water of 20 DEG C to spray 3 maintenances every 3 days and show native relative moisture at 65%-75%, prothallus development becomes in the process of true leaf, growth temperature is controlled at 25 DEG C, shade density 80%-85%.
9) obtain bracken spore seedling: after planting 120 days, highly reach 20-23cm, the rice shoot of the long 20-30cm of underground rhizome is seedling, can transplant.
